What are energy-based treatments?
How they work
Energy-based treatments use acoustic waves or radiofrequency energy. They stimulate a biological response in penile tissue below the surface. Nothing is injected and nothing is introduced into the body — the energy itself triggers the response.
Shockwave therapy uses acoustic waves specifically. These waves create controlled microtrauma in penile tissue. That microtrauma stimulates the body’s natural repair process, promotes new blood vessel formation, and improves vascular health over time.

Shockwave therapy (LiSWT) has the most clinical evidence of any non-surgical ED treatment on this site. Multiple randomized controlled trials support it. However, major guideline bodies disagree on how ready it is for routine use. The European Association of Urology (EAU) guideline lists LiSWT as an option for men with mild organic ED, or for those who respond poorly to PDE5 inhibitors, but labels this a “weak strength” recommendation. The American Urological Association (AUA), by contrast, classifies shockwave therapy for ED as investigational (Grade C evidence) and generally recommends it be pursued within research protocols rather than as routine paid care.
Results vary by patient and protocol. Published trials report modest average improvements rather than dramatic ones.
Apex RF, by contrast, is less studied at guideline level. Most of the evidence supporting RF for sexual health comes from smaller studies and clinical experience, not large randomized trials.
Current evidence does not support shockwave therapy for reducing penile curvature in Peyronie’s disease, despite some marketing claims. Energy-based treatments are also not effective for all causes of ED — proper diagnosis of the underlying cause is essential before choosing any therapy.

Combination approaches
Energy-based treatments combined with other therapies
Some providers combine energy-based treatments with regenerative therapies. Together they form part of a comprehensive men’s sexual health plan. This is an emerging area — not yet standard care, though clinical interest is growing.
The most commonly combined approach
Shockwave therapy primes the vascular environment. PRP then delivers growth factors to the same tissue. In theory, the two work together synergistically. Early studies suggest a potential improvement in erectile function scores beyond either treatment alone.
This combination is still considered emerging. More large-scale evidence is needed before it becomes standard protocol.

Are energy-based treatments FDA-approved for ED?
Most shockwave devices are FDA-cleared for musculoskeletal uses, but their use for erectile dysfunction is typically off-label in the US. Some devices have approvals outside the US specifically for ED. Apex RF devices may have separate FDA clearances. Use for ED is legal and common — but patients should understand it is off-label use in most cases.
How many shockwave sessions are needed?
Most shockwave protocols involve 6–12 sessions over several weeks, typically 2 sessions per week. Protocols vary between providers and devices. Some men see improvement after a full course; others require maintenance sessions. Your provider will recommend a protocol based on your response.
Can these treatments replace Viagra or Cialis?
Not necessarily — but for some men they may reduce reliance on medications or improve medication response. ED medications address symptoms temporarily. Shockwave therapy aims to address underlying vascular health. Some men use both — shockwave to work on root causes while continuing medication as needed during the treatment period.
Does shockwave therapy work for Peyronie’s disease?
No. Current evidence does not support shockwave therapy for reducing penile curvature in Peyronie’s disease, despite some marketing claims to the contrary. In some clinical settings, shockwave is used alongside other Peyronie’s treatments. Be cautious of any provider claiming it treats curvature on its own. What is GAINSWave® and how does it differ from shockwave therapy?
GAINSWave® is a branded marketing protocol for acoustic wave therapy. It uses standard shockwave technology — the brand name doesn’t refer to a unique device or mechanism. Treatment under the GAINSWave® name relies on the same underlying acoustic wave technology as other shockwave treatments. What actually determines your results is device quality, protocol, and provider experience, not the brand name.
Is there downtime after shockwave or Apex RF?
No significant downtime. Both treatments are performed in-office and most men return to normal daily activity immediately. Some mild temporary sensitivity in the treated area is possible. Neither treatment requires recovery time the way injection-based or surgical procedures do.
